Turn bench over.  Install hinge

brackets to ends of bench.

Secure using 5/16” X 1.5” Allen-

head bolts and 5/16” metal

washers.  Tighten bolt snug, 

then an additional half turn.

3

Using six 5/16” X 1” bolts and six 5/16” washers, fasten the

legs to the bench as shown, with the two small skirt

mounting holes toward the back, by installing the

center bolt first.  You may have to gently push the sides

of the legs in to align holes.  Tighten with the allen

wrench.

2

Lay the bench upside down on the floor.  Locate the two stand legs.

1

Assembly Procedures

Lift the canopy and hold it

between the hinge brackets.

4

Insert 5/16” X 1.5” bolts

with 5/16” washers into both

hinge brackets.  Tighten bolts

into the endcap threaded inserts

until snug, then an additional 

half turn.  Do not overtighten

to avoid damaging threaded 

inserts.

5

Long Bolt

The gas springs have

a locking mechanism.

Pry back the 

locking clip

with a flat

screwdriver.

6

With a helper holding the canopy open, align ends of gas spring ball joints

with pivot studs and push into place.  Be sure rod end is down as shown.

7

DO NOT lower canopy until both

gas springs are engaged!

Lift and lower the canopy a few times to lubricate

gas springs for optimum performance.

8

Plug the three-prong power cord into the proper

dedicated outlet.  32R models are to be hard-wired.

(*See Electrical Requirements.)

9

CAUTION 

Voltage for 120V beds must

be between105-125 VAC.

Voltage for 220V beds must

be between215-230 VAC or

will void warranty.

!

CAUTION

 

Failure to engage locking clips may

result in the ball joints working loose,

allowing the canopy to fall, which may

result in damage to the unit and injury.

!
